The real-world consequences of the cloud
Private companies spend billions of dollars stuffing warehouses full of servers and expend huge amounts of energy keeping them cool. Nor is the cloud neutral political territory, with technological and ideological roots stretching back to the Cold War, when the military needed a communication network that wouldn’t fail even if many of its nodes and pathways were taken out by a nuclear bomb.

Nexus 6P users complaining about microphone issues

Google and Huawei just can’t seem to catch a breath. After the bend test videos and the more recent glass shattering, the Huawei manufactured Nexus 6P seems to be having another issue: poor microphone quality.

Users are reporting that the other person on the call is unable to hear them properly. This happens in regular voice calls and also in VoIP calls, such as in Hangouts. Some have reported it only in speakerphone mode and others in both speakerphone and earpiece mode. The issue seems to be widespread enough, with people on Google Forums, xda-developers, and on reddit having the same issue.

Google is currently aware of the issue and is investigating it further.
